Enjoyable

Took my 7 year old golfing for the first time and we really enjoyed ourselves.
I wasn't sure what to expect at a starters course. I wasn't sure if he would be able to get through it all or if he would be frustrated. The course lends itself to beginners better than expected. The fairways are straight, the greens are perfect for a starter, only limited sand traps which are placed out of the way a bit so rare to land in one. They are flatter than most traps so even if you land in one it is very achievable to get out on the first try.
The pace was good and it wasn't just kids there. In front of us was a group of 5 adults. Behind us was an older couple. Was a great experience. I'm looking forward to future rounds there.
Thank you!
